This equipment generates, uses, and radiates radio frequency energy. If not installed and used
in accordance with the instructions, this may cause harmful interference to radio or television
reception. However, there is no guarantee that interference will not occur in a particular installation.
If this equipment causes interference to radio and television reception. To determined, try by
turning the equipment off and on. If the interference does occur the user is encouraged
to try to correct the interference by one or more of the following measures:
•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na;
•Increase the separation between the equipment and receiver;
•Connect the equipment into an outlet on a circuit from that to which the receiver is connected.
Caution
To prevent fire, shock hazard, or interference, only use the recommended accessories. To
prevent electric shock, do not use the plug with an extension cord, receptacle, or other outlet
unless the blades can be fully inserted to prevent blade exposure. To reduce the risk of electric
shock, do not remove the unit cover or back. There are no serviceable parts inside. Refer
servicing to a qualified personnel only.

This symbol is intended to alert the user to the presence of uninsulated dangerous
voltage within the product’s enclosure that may be of sufficient magnitude to
constitute risk of fire or electric shock.
This symbol is intended to alert the user to the presence of important operating
and maintence instructions in the literature accompanying this product.
